McMillan Fiberglass Stocks, McMillan Firearms Manufacturing,
McMillan Group International have been collectively banking
with Bank of America for 12 years.

Today Mr. Ray Fox, Senior Vice President, Marlet Manager, Business
Banking, Global Commercial Banking ( Bank of America ) came to my office.

He scheduled the meeting as an "account analysis" meeting in order to
evaluate the two lines of credit we have with them.
He spent 5 minutes talking about how McMillan has changed in the last 5
years and have become more of a firearms manufacturer
than a supplier of accessories.

At this point I interrupted him and asked "Can I possibly save
you some time so that you don't waste your breath?
What you are going to tell me is that because we are in the firearms manufacturing business
you no longer want my business."
"That is correct", he says.
I replied "That is okay, we will move our accounts as soon as possible.
We can find a 2nd Amendment friendly bank that will be glad
to have our business.
You won't mind if I tell the NRA, SCI and everyone one I know
that BofA is not firearms-industry friendly?"
"You have to do what you must", he said.
"So you are telling me this is a politically motivated decision,
is that right?"

Mr. Fox confirmed that it was.

At which point I told him that the meeting was over and there was nothing left for him to say.
I think it is important for all Americans who believe in and support our 2nd
amendment "right to keep and bear arms" should know when a business
does not support these rights.

What you do with that knowledge is up to you.
When I don't agree with a business' political position,
I cannot, in good conscience support them.

We will soon no longer be accepting Bank of America credit cards
as payment for our products.
